Calibre the save template to name the files when you send them to the device. The default is something like:

Code:
{author_sort}/{title} - {authors}
To get what you are seeing, someone has changed the template to include "#amazon". It might be hardcoded or a tag or something else. Look at the driver configuration to see what the template you are using is.
